Slan-like tendrils on one's head can be used for small item storage.

In A.E. Van Vogt's classic science fiction novel "Slan", the eponymous race of beings are telepaths with prehensile tendrils on their heads. But having many flexible tendrils on your head would be useful for purposes other than telepathy.

My Nifty Slan-Cap is a hat covered in many short, flexible lengths of wire, or "tendrils". Whenever I have to carry something small—a pencil, a ping pong ball, some spare change—I stick it on my head and wrap some tendrils around it, and my hands are free for other activities.
